The world’s economy is at another pivotal stage as technologies such as artificial intelligence, the Internet of Things (IoT), and virtual/augmented reality transition from early stage applications to engines of economic growth. A critical catalyst to realize this growth is the fifth generation of wireless technology, or 5G. 5G is not simply an extension of 4G, nor is it merely a faster wireless capability offering more capacity and enhanced performance for smartphones. 5G makes possible the connection and interaction of billions of devices of almost any kind and collection of data from those devices. In addition to connecting people to people through their smartphones, 5G connects an unlimited number of things, which can communicate all day, every day. The business opportunity for 5G technology to influence productivity and automation is anticipated to have a seismic impact to macro economies.

In addition, 5G solutions will also involve an architectural shift where critical analytics and artificial intelligence functions will be executed in close proximity to the connected devices. Edge computing capabilities enabled by 5G will drive higher accuracy, efficiency, and results to the device or devices across secure private or public networks. Further, in typically low connectively locations, such as oil rigs, mining, and agriculture, 5G makes it possible for IoT devices with minimal computing power and low-speed connectivity to “behave” like powerful computers using a similar 5G/edge computing architecture.

Enabled by 5G, the volume and variety of connected device types and the data they generate and consume are expected to dramatically increase within and across enterprises. This networking technology now provides a range of customizable capabilities that can be “fit for purpose” to specific solution requirements, resulting in game changing opportunities to drive new revenue streams and unprecedented operating efficiencies. For example, in retail, next generation personalized customer experience is now possible with on-site intelligent analytics that combines location based, realtime customer data with accurate pricing, inventory and competitive information across stores and regions. In manufacturing, high performance campus 5G networks can simultaneously raise the quality of precision manufacturing with real time sensors, while untethered factory robots bring new levels of flexibility. The low latency property of 5G also provides numerous opportunities to realize the potential of the examples provided above.

5G will likely create numerous business opportunities across all industries. To be able to realize the benefits, many business processes and solution architectures will need to be overhauled. Frank Wilde, Vice President, Global Center of Excellence at SAP Wilde leads data and data science innovation focused on telecom and high tech as a Vice President for SAP’s Global Center of excellence. In this role, Frank’s teams of data scientists and platform architects spark innovative thinking with SAP’s customers through a combination of data science and design thinking. Frank is a seasoned executive with a track record of success in product innovation, sales and sales operations. Before joining SAP, Frank led a software development group at Apple which supported Apple’s strategic partnerships with IBM, Cisco and AT&T. Prior to Apple, Frank led a corporate strategy organization and a sales innovation organization at Dell. At Dell, his teams designed and built Dell’s first consumer loyalty platform and created a competitive version of iTunes. In addition, Frank spent 9 years with Deloitte Consulting leading digital transformations with high tech, telecom, and public sector clients. He began his career as a software engineer building CRM and supply chain applications before transitioning into management consulting.

13

Frank attended University of California, Los Angeles, for college, earned an MBA of Business Administration at Duke University and served as an officer in the Navy.

5G – Its Potential Impact in SMART Manufacturing

5G technology will create an unprecedented fabric of connected devices, pushing the wireless revolution well beyond handsets, enabling widespread connectivity of just about everything, including laptops, vehicles, IoT devices, manufacturing plants, and city infrastructure. Businesses, governments and consumers will reap the benefits of multi-gigabit speeds, ultra-low latency, simplistic scalability, and virtually unlimited capacity. While the full benefits of the 5G rollout is on the near horizon, one of the earliest beneficiaries is expected to be manufacturing. In the semiconductor industry, 5G is being hailed as an enabling technology for “smart manufacturing” that uses production and sensor data to improve manufacturing efficiencies and adaptability. With greater reliability and peak data speeds that will be at least 20 times that of 4G networks, 5G will enable wafer fabs to use wireless technology for many quality control and predictive maintenance applications that existing networks cannot.

For example, 5G speeds makes it possible to apply edge or cloud-based AI technologies to packaging and inspection steps, improving quality and yield. 5G will also help maximize the uptime of manufacturing equipment, enabling technicians to perform maintenance and repair operations remotely. The streaming of sensor data over 5G networks will not only enable fabs to build chips more efficiently and reduce waste, they will also provide real-time data on the environmental conditions within a fab, delivering immediate warnings in the cases of chemical-related worker safety hazards. Currently, chip makers and equipment vendors are showcasing real-use examples for 5G. In the case of brand-new “greenfield” chip fabs, investing in 5G infrastructure is a no-brainer, as the high-speed wireless connectivity will reduce the amount of hardwired infrastructure required. In the case of existing fabs, SEMI members are weighing the return on investment associated with replacing existing networks with 5G. The future ahead and potential impact for 5G is bright indeed.
